Review of Seven Swords (2005) by C0Ncept B — 28 Jan 2009
I would recommend watching the original Chinese series first, then watching this -- it's much more appreciable if you are already familiar with the story. I compare this and the full mini-series with the David Lynch version of Dune vs.
the Sci-Fi Channel mini-series. This is an extremely well done movie, but due to the size and complexity of the story has necessarily been cut down to a form more palatable to a regular audience. Still, the cinematography and choreography are excellent, and if you already are familiar with the story you will get so much more out of this movie.
I originally watched the short version of the film and did find it somewhat difficult to follow and get into, but I could tell there was something there, so I went out and bought the original series. I'm on Episode 25 now and I'm completely hooked.
